Obituary-William Fredrick Delbridge

William Fredrick Delbridge Jr. of Allegan, passed away peacefully on May 16, 2022. William was born on December 4, 1949 to his late parents William, and Ruth (Craft) Delbridge in West Branch, Michigan. After graduating high school, he would go on to serve in the Army during Vietnam as a door gunner. He would faithfully and honorably serve his country and fellow servicemen for 4 years. After William was honorably discharged from the Army, he would meet the love of his life Lori (Grable) Delbridge of Arkansas. Wiilliam would go on to work with Parker Hanifin for 40 plus years and retire comfortably from there. He was loyal to his core, in work, with family and his friends. He loved his country and country men and supported them in whatever way he could. William was a working man that could do pretty much anything he set his mind too. From working on cars, farm equipment and house projects he could do it better the most and save a lot of money doing it. He loved relationships and being able to relate to anyone that came his way. He was caring, thoughtful, and full of stories. William was an avid outdoorsman and enjoyed spending time in the woods hunting or at the pond fishing. When he would have spare time, which was sparse, he would paint and build model cars and train sets of all kinds. He is already deeply missed by his family and friends.
He is survived by his wife Lori (Grable) Delbridge; sisters Roberta and (Bob) Stewart, Florence Hitchcock; sons Christopher Delbridge, and William Delbridge III ; grandkids Daniel, David, Julia, Tiffany, and Will; and great-grandchild Azrael.
He is preceded in death by his parents and sister Patricia Delbridge.
The family will be having a memorial service at a later date.
Donations may be made to Allegan American Legion Post 89, 632 Eastern Avenue, Allegan, MI 49010.
